In compressed air systems, filter elements serve as critical guardians of air quality, directly impacting equipment longevity, energy efficiency, and product quality across industries from semiconductor fabrication to pharmaceutical production. Industrial facilities worldwide face persistent challenges: OEM filter elements command premium pricing 30-50% above aftermarket alternatives, procurement cycles extend to weeks causing unplanned downtime, and standard filtration media often degrade prematurely in harsh chemical or high-temperature environments. These pain points translate to inflated operational costs, production interruptions, and compromised air purity that can trigger catastrophic product defects.

  1. Headline Filters

Headline Filters specializes in aftermarket compressed air filter elements with direct replacement compatibility for Kaeser filter housings. Product offerings include particulate filters with 0.01μm to 40μm ratings, oil removal coalescing filters achieving residual oil content below 0.01mg/m³, and activated carbon adsorbers for vapor-phase contaminant removal. The company utilizes borosilicate microfiber and cellulose media configurations depending on application requirements. Headline provides technical support for filter selection based on operating pressure, temperature, and flow rate parameters. Inventory management programs enable scheduled deliveries aligned with maintenance intervals.

  1. Walker Filtration

Walker Filtration manufactures replacement compressed air filter elements through UK and North American production facilities serving global markets. The company's Grade H filters achieve 0.01μm particulate removal with oil aerosol reduction to 0.01ppm for high-purity applications. Walker elements feature epoxy-bonded end caps and nitrile or Viton seal options for chemical compatibility. Product lines include standard threaded elements and large diameter cartridges for high-flow industrial installations. The division offers filter performance verification through oil carryover testing and particle counting services. Cross-reference databases facilitate identification of equivalent replacements for Kaeser OEM part numbers.
